Skip to content

Commit

Permalink
update jenkins dockerfiles
Browse files Browse the repository at this point in the history
  • Loading branch information
mcnewton committed Jul 31, 2019
1 parent 1212e63 commit 89f6580
Show file tree
Hide file tree
Showing 6 changed files with 31 additions and 17 deletions.
5 changes: 3 additions & 2 deletions scripts/docker/build-debian10/Dockerfile.jenkins
Expand Up @@ -8,9 +8,10 @@ ARG DEBIAN_FRONTEND=noninteractive
#
# This is necessary for the jenkins server to talk to the docker instance
#
# RUN echo deb http://ftp.debian.org/debian ${osname}-backports main >> /etc/apt/sources.list
RUN apt-get update && \
apt-get install -y openjdk-11-jre-headless openssh-server sudo
apt-get install -y openjdk-11-jre-headless \
openssh-server \
sudo

RUN useradd -m jenkins
RUN echo "jenkins:jenkins1" | chpasswd
Expand Down
9 changes: 6 additions & 3 deletions scripts/docker/build-debian8/Dockerfile.jenkins
Expand Up @@ -8,9 +8,12 @@ ARG DEBIAN_FRONTEND=noninteractive
#
# This is necessary for the jenkins server to talk to the docker instance
#
RUN echo deb http://ftp.debian.org/debian ${osname}-backports main >> /etc/apt/sources.list
RUN apt-get update && apt-get -t ${osname}-backports install -y openjdk-8-jre-headless
RUN apt-get install -y openssh-server sudo
RUN echo "deb [check-valid-until=no] http://archive.debian.org/debian ${osname}-backports main" >> /etc/apt/sources.list
RUN echo 'Acquire::Check-Valid-Until "false";' >> /etc/apt/apt.conf
RUN apt-get update && \
apt-get -t ${osname}-backports install -y openjdk-8-jre-headless
RUN apt-get install -y openssh-server \
sudo

RUN useradd -m jenkins
RUN echo "jenkins:jenkins1" | chpasswd
Expand Down
7 changes: 4 additions & 3 deletions scripts/docker/build-debian9/Dockerfile.jenkins
Expand Up @@ -8,9 +8,10 @@ ARG DEBIAN_FRONTEND=noninteractive
#
# This is necessary for the jenkins server to talk to the docker instance
#
RUN echo deb http://ftp.debian.org/debian ${osname}-backports main >> /etc/apt/sources.list
RUN apt-get update && apt-get -t ${osname}-backports install -y openjdk-8-jre-headless
RUN apt-get install -y openssh-server sudo
RUN apt-get update && \
apt-get install -y openjdk-8-jre-headless \
openssh-server \
sudo

RUN useradd -m jenkins
RUN echo "jenkins:jenkins1" | chpasswd
Expand Down
9 changes: 6 additions & 3 deletions scripts/docker/build-ubuntu14/Dockerfile.jenkins
Expand Up @@ -8,10 +8,13 @@ ARG DEBIAN_FRONTEND=noninteractive
#
# This is necessary for the jenkins server to talk to the docker instance
#
RUN apt-get update && \
apt-get install -y software-properties-common
RUN apt-add-repository ppa:openjdk-r/ppa
RUN apt-get update && apt-get install -y openjdk-8-jre-headless

RUN apt-get install -y openssh-server sudo
RUN apt-get update && \
apt-get install -y openjdk-8-jre-headless \
openssh-server \
sudo

RUN useradd -m jenkins
RUN echo "jenkins:jenkins1" | chpasswd
Expand Down
9 changes: 6 additions & 3 deletions scripts/docker/build-ubuntu16/Dockerfile.jenkins
Expand Up @@ -8,10 +8,13 @@ ARG DEBIAN_FRONTEND=noninteractive
#
# This is necessary for the jenkins server to talk to the docker instance
#
RUN apt-get update && \
apt-get install -y software-properties-common
RUN apt-add-repository ppa:openjdk-r/ppa
RUN apt-get update && apt-get install -y openjdk-8-jre-headless

RUN apt-get install -y openssh-server sudo
RUN apt-get update && \
apt-get install -y openjdk-8-jre-headless \
openssh-server \
sudo

RUN useradd -m jenkins
RUN echo "jenkins:jenkins1" | chpasswd
Expand Down
9 changes: 6 additions & 3 deletions scripts/docker/build-ubuntu18/Dockerfile.jenkins
Expand Up @@ -8,10 +8,13 @@ ARG DEBIAN_FRONTEND=noninteractive
#
# This is necessary for the jenkins server to talk to the docker instance
#
RUN apt-get update && \
apt-get install -y software-properties-common
RUN apt-add-repository ppa:openjdk-r/ppa
RUN apt-get update && apt-get install -y openjdk-8-jre-headless

RUN apt-get install -y openssh-server sudo
RUN apt-get update && \
apt-get install -y openjdk-8-jre-headless \
openssh-server \
sudo

RUN useradd -m jenkins
RUN echo "jenkins:jenkins1" | chpasswd
Expand Down

0 comments on commit 89f6580

Please sign in to comment.